The role that retinoblastoma has played in our understanding of cancer biology could hardly have been imagined 40 years ago when this disease was a rare curiosity, of interest primarily because of its variable laterality, occasional dominant inheritance, frequent lethality and embyronal origin. It is second only to uveal melanoma in the frequency of occurrence of malignant intraocular tumors. Hpv infection is known to cause cervical cancer and has also been implicated in the pathogenesis of retinoblastoma rb, a common intraocular malignant tumor of childhood which can be familial or sporadic.

Children diagnosed with the hereditary form of retinoblastoma rb, a rare eye cancer caused by a germline mutation in the rb1 tumor suppressor gene, have excellent survival, but face an increased risk of bone and soft tissue sarcomas. This predisposition to sarcomas has been attributed to genetic susceptibility due to inactivation of the rb1 gene as well as past radiotherapy for rb. Treatment of retinoblastoma aims to save the patients life and uses an individualized, riskadapted approach to minimize systemic exposure to drugs, optimize ocular drug delivery, and preserve useful vision. For patients with extraocular retinoblastoma, intensive chemotherapy is required, including highdose chemotherapy and autologous hematopoietic stem cell rescue.
